Abstract

This paper and video are devoted to the last experiments and demonstration of the AWARE project (European Commission, FP6) carried out in Utrera, near Seville (Spain) May, 2009. The project has developed and validated in field experiments a platform providing the functionalities required for the cooperation of aerial robots with ground sensor-actuator wireless networks, including static and mobile nodes carried by people and vehicles. The project demonstrated the self-deployment, self-configuration and self-repairing of the network by using autonomous helicopters that transported and deployed sensor nodes and loads. These features are highly relevant in natural and urban environments without pre-existing infrastructure or where the infrastructure has been damaged or destroyed. Two validation scenarios have been considered: Disaster Management/Civil Security and Filming.
